HMH Custom Remodeling, based in Fort Wayne, specializes in bathroom work - a sensible focus for aging-in-place modifications, since bathrooms are where most falls occur and where accessibility matters most in daily life. The company is licensed and operates from a Fort Wayne address, serving the local area where nearly two-thirds of homes are owner-occupied and over fourteen percent of residents are age sixty-five and older.

Their stated aging-in-place services span the practical range: grab bar installation, walk-in tub and shower conversions, non-slip flooring, countertop lowering, and ADA-compliant toilet installation. These are the kinds of modifications that let people stay in their own homes safely as mobility or balance changes. A bathroom retrofit done well can be the difference between independence and moving to assisted living.

The company's own description emphasizes bathroom and kitchen remodels as their main work, alongside roofing, windows, and room additions - the kind of full-service contractor scope that sometimes means bathroom accessibility work sits alongside other trades. Early ratings suggest positive feedback from at least one recent customer, though the single five-star review represents a small sample and shouldn't be treated as an established track record.
